customer status filter bug fixes

This commit is contained in:
Donghuang 2023-05-26 16:10:14 +08:00
parent 53d285cb33
commit d51f1abf67

View File

@ -221,7 +221,11 @@ public class CustomerController
*/
@Override
protected Search defaultFilter(final Search search) {
return search.ne(CRITERION_COLS.get("status"), CustomerProperty.STATUS_NA_ID);
val statusCol = CRITERION_COLS.get("status");
return search.and(new Search()
.notNull(statusCol)
.ne(statusCol, CustomerProperty.STATUS_NA_ID)
.or(statusCol, null));
}
/**